A lightweight and flexible job queue library for PHP with database-backed persistence and object-oriented job handling. Supports scheduled execution, retries, job expiration, indexed job types, automatic deletion of completed jobs, and type-safe job classes.
🧰 Features
- Type-Safe Jobs – Object-oriented job classes with
JobInterface - Job Retries – Configurable max retry attempts before marking as failed
- Job Expiration – Automatic expiration via
expires_attimestamp - Indexed Job Types – Fast filtering by
type - Row-Level Locking – Prevents concurrent execution of the same job
- Transactional Safety – All job operations are executed within a transaction
- Optional Process Locking – Prevent overlapping workers using
LockGuard - Optional Deletion on Success – Set
deleteOnSuccess: trueto automatically delete jobs after success - Dependency Injection – Support for PSR-11 containers and factory methods for automatic dependency injection

## 📋 Requirements
- **PHP**: >= 8.2
- **Extensions**:
- `ext-json` - for JSON payload handling
- `ext-posix` - for LockGuard process locking (optional)
- **Dependencies**:
- `doctrine/dbal` - for database operations
This package uses Doctrine DBAL for database abstraction, providing support for multiple database platforms (MySQL, PostgreSQL, SQLite, SQL Server, Oracle, etc.) with consistent API.

💉 Dependency Injection
JobQueue supports automatic dependency injection through PSR-11 containers and factory methods. This allows jobs to access services without serializing them into the queue.
Setup with Container
Pass a PSR-11 container to the JobQueue constructor:
use Solo\JobQueue\JobQueue; use Psr\Container\ContainerInterface; $queue = new JobQueue( connection: $connection, table: 'jobs', maxRetries: 5, deleteOnSuccess: true, container: $container // PSR-11 container );
Create Job with Factory Method
Jobs that need dependencies should:
- Store only data (not services) in constructor
- Implement
JsonSerializableto serialize only data - Provide a static
createFromContainerfactory method
use Solo\Contracts\JobQueue\JobInterface; use Psr\Container\ContainerInterface; class ProcessOrderJob implements JobInterface, \JsonSerializable { private ?OrderRepository $orderRepository = null; private ?PaymentService $paymentService = null; public function __construct( private readonly int $orderId ) { } /** * Factory method for creating job with dependencies from container */ public static function createFromContainer(ContainerInterface $container, array $data): self { $job = new self($data['orderId']); // Inject dependencies from container $job->orderRepository = $container->get(OrderRepository::class); $job->paymentService = $container->get(PaymentService::class); return $job; } /** * Serialize only data (not dependencies) for queue storage */ public function jsonSerialize(): array { return [ 'orderId' => $this->orderId ]; } public function handle(): void { $order = $this->orderRepository->find($this->orderId); $this->paymentService->process($order); } }
How It Works
- When pushing to queue: Only data from
jsonSerialize()is stored in the database - When processing: JobQueue checks if the job class has a
createFromContainermethod - If found: Uses the factory method to create the job instance with dependencies
- If not found: Falls back to direct instantiation with serialized data
This approach keeps your queue storage clean while enabling full dependency injection support.

🧪 API Methods
| Method | Description |
|---|---|
install() |
Create the jobs table |
push(JobInterface $job, ?string $type = null, ?DateTimeImmutable $scheduledAt = null, ?DateTimeImmutable $expiresAt = null) |
Push job to the queue with optional type filtering |
addJob(array $payload, ?DateTimeImmutable $scheduledAt = null, ?DateTimeImmutable $expiresAt = null, ?string $type = null) |
Add job to the queue using raw payload data |
getPendingJobs(int $limit = 10, ?string $onlyType = null) |
Retrieve ready-to-run jobs, optionally filtered by type |
markCompleted(int $jobId) |
Mark job as completed |
markFailed(int $jobId, string $error = '') |
Mark job as failed with error message |
processJobs(int $limit = 10, ?string $onlyType = null) |
Process pending jobs |
